Maharashtra Governor BS Koshyari was denied an official plane on Thursday. Koshyari was supposed to fly to Mussoorie in Uttarakhand for a function at the Lal Bahadur Shastri National Academy of Administration. However, when the governor was about to board the plane, he was informed that his flight does not have permission to fly.
As per an official statement from the governor s office, Koshyari is scheduled to preside over an official programme the Valedictory Function of the 122nd Induction Training Programme of IAS officers at the Lal Bahadur Shastri National Academy of Administration at Mussoorie, Uttarakhand on Friday.

Maharashtra Governor Bhagat Singh Koshyari was scheduled to travel by a state government aircraft to Dehradun in Uttarakhand on Thursday, but the permission to use the plane was not granted even as the Governor had boarded the aircraft, sources said.
The Governor later took a commercial flight to travel to Dehradun, a statement from the Raj Bhavan said.
This comes amid uneasy ties between the state’s Shiv Sena-NCP-Congress coalition government and the governor, with both the sides have being critical of each other in the past.
The Raj Bhavan statement said the Governor’s Secretariat had written to the government authorities seeking permission for the use of aircraft “well in advance” on February 2.
